The power and transition into boost and vtec is smooth and linear. Here is my setup:
1999 Honda Prelude Type SH
H22A4-stock bottem end
AEM EMS
Cometic HP style 0.057" headgasket
Portflow PnP head
entire Ferrea valvetrain with 0.5 mm overstock SS valves on intake and exhaust
RC Eng. 440 saturated injectors
Walbro 255 lph fuel pump
AEM camgears, fuel rail, fpr, and pulleys
Fmax turbo kit (modified to fit a bigger turbo)
Garrett T3/T4E stage 3 with 0.63 a/r and 60 trim with 0.60 a/r
2.5" testpipe and Apexi N1 exhaust
